* The close relationships of the four lead characters:
** Cheong-san and Su-hyeok are the most obvious with their brotherhood and fun banters, and after the outbreak, they look out for each other in both fighting the infected and personal problems.
** Cheong-san and On-jo: classic childhood friendship with jokes and protectiveness. She is the most worried when Cheong-san disappears and tries any way to find him back and of course Cheong-san always protects her when everything goes bad.
** Cheong-san and Nam-ra: while they are at disagreement in most of their screen time, at least Cheong-san tolerates Nam-ra for Su-hyeok's sake and Nam-ra does not judge him at all for his actions against her.
** Su-hyeok and On-jo: besides being normal good friends before shits go down, Su-hyeok protects On-jo from any dangers when Cheong-san is not around and after On-jo lost him, Su-hyeok becomes her close friend during her four-month self-isolation.
** Su-hyeok and Nam-ra: mutual crushes; they start awkward but after realizing their feelings for each other, they protect each other fiercely. Su-hyeok tries his hardest to protect Nam-ra when she was infected and everyone became wary of her while with her new powers, Nam-ra helps Su-hyeok and the group to survive the outbreak.
** On-jo and Nam-ra: while On-jo hates her at first, she is the first person to vouch for Nam-ra's possible immunity to the virus after Gwi-nam bit her and after accepting Su-hyeok and Nam-ra's relationship, helps the girl to open up to her friends. They become closer to the point that Nam-ra is the one hugging On-jo when the latter lost Cheong-san and On-jo is very determined to find Nam-ra again.

!Episode 6
* This episode is basically the highlight for On-jo's emotional intelligence and why she is the main character that glues the group together despite the Western fanbase's dislike towards this kind of character:
** At the beginning, she is the only one who stays with the grieving Ji-min to make her have someone to talk to and tells her not to lose hope. Before running out to find Cheong-san, On-jo holds her hand and tells her not to let go.
** Knowing Cheong-san would not listen even after the group tells him to stay, On-jo contacts him through the microphone (remember, Cheong-san can hear what she says but not vice-versa) to beg him to stay despite his usual attitude towards her. And it works.
** When Nam-ra was found bitten by Gwi-nam and Cheong-san and Su-hyeok get into a heated argument which eventually escalates into a physical fight, despite her earlier jealously, On-jo protects Nam-ra by pointing out she did not have blood on her mouth, logically proving both Cheong-san and Su-hyeok have no reason to lie about Gwi-nam's situation, deflecting Ji-min's (understandably) cynical comments and comforting Nam-ra. Even when she insists she still hates her, it is clear that On-jo places friendship and staying together first and foremost.
* Also, Su-hyeok gets the spotlight as well:
** Despite the bite wound, Su-hyeok barely hesitates before helping Nam-ra up and joining the group.
** He protects Nam-ra from the group's growing fear, especially Cheong-san's proactive intent on killing her, even taking a hit for her when it looks like she bit him. After that, he ties his hand with Nam-ra's to make sure only he and Nam-ra are amongst the casualties if she bites him.
!Episode 7
* Nam-ra and Su-hyeok confessing their mutual interest towards each other, marked with a kiss (and Nam-ra is the one to initiate it!)
* On-jo convinces Su-hyeok and Nam-ra to untie their hands to make sure Nam-ra can integrate into the group, pointing out while fear can spread out amongst the group, so can trust. She even calls Nam-ra by name and smiles when Nam-ra says she should have been the president of the class.
